Enjoining orders against Silumina further extended

0 7

The Associated Newspapers of Ceylon Limited (Lake House) filing objections in a case where Sri Lanka Cricket President and Vice President sought enjoining orders that prohibit the Silumina newspaper, from publishing any content related to SLC and its officials requested the Colombo District Court yesterday to reject the case on the first instance without taking it to trial.

It was pointed out that the plaintiffs have fraudulently and deceptively concealed the necessary facts and obtained Enjoining Orders and requested to terminate the obtained Enjoining Orders and dismiss the case.

In the objections it is further stated that the publication of articles in the Silumina newspaper regarding Sri Lanka Cricket is only a disclosure of the facts to the public for the public good, and that the defendants had no intention of harming the plaintiffs or anyone else.

When this case was called before Colombo Chief District Judge Sandun Vithana yesterday, the relevant Enjoining Orders was extended till August 4 and the defendants presented objections to the Court through a motion.

SLC President and Vice President filed these cases stating that two articles published in the Silumina newspaper on April 23 and June 18, 2023 has defamed SLC.

Journalist Fawz Mohammed and ANCL have been named as defendants in the case. After unilaterally considering the relevant complaint, the Colombo Chief District Judge had issued these Enjoining Orders on July 26. Attorney for the defendants. I.M. Jayawardena had submitted these objections to the court.
